MARS HILL – Stetson H. “Ted” Hussey Jr., 86, died March 31, 2005 at a Bangor hospital. He was born June 20, 1918, in Mars Hill, the son of Stetson H. and Gladys (Goodhue) Hussey Sr. He was an Eagle Scout at the age of 14. He was a 1937 graduate from Aroostook Central Institute in Mars Hill. He graduated from Bowdoin College in 1941 and from Boston University School of Law in 1948. Ted became associated with his father, Stetson H. Hussey Sr. in the practice of Law in Mars Hill on May 8, 1948, to the present time. He was a veteran of World War II, 1st Lieutenant and served in the South Pacific for 38 months, his platoon being assigned to various Regimental Combat Teams. Ted was a member and Past President of the Aroostook Bar Association and a member of the Maine Bar Association. He was an advisory director of the Northern National Bank for approximately 20 years. He was one of the Founding Fathers of the Aroostook Health Center in Mars Hill; a Charter Member and Past President of the Mars Hill Rotary Club and was a Paul Harris Fellow. Ted was a member of the American Legion Post No. 118, Mars Hill, a member of Aroostook Masonic Lodge No. 197, Mars Hill and a member of the Mars Hill United Methodist church. He was a member of the Aroostook Valley Country Club and the Mars Hill Country Club. In 1998, Ted was presented a plaque for Outstanding Citizen of the Year and Role Model; a plaque presented for Outstanding Service for the Support of Girl Scouting and the “Health 2000 Youth Educating Youth” Program, a plaque presented by the Maine State Bar Association in recognition of 50 Years of practice in the legal profession; and a medal for 50 years membership in the Masonic Lodge.
